Pours clear dilute gold with nice bumpy off white head. The aroma begins a bit metallic and then mildly floral, spicy and sweet. A deeper draw drums up some fruity esters. The taste has an even mix of sweet malts and spicy hops. To midway a sense of floral hops and earthiness pick up with hop bitterness growing to tepid levels and then lingering nicely into the after taste. Seems pleasingly hop forward for the style.

From my beer club. Sampled from a 12 oz brown bottle this beer poured a slightly cloudy pale yellow color with a small soapy white head that produced some lacing. The aroma was faintly fruity and tangy. The flavor was tart, tangy and a bit sour with faint fruits and some chalk. The finish was dry and chalky. Medium body. Eh.
